Prosciutto-Wrapped Pears with Blue Cheese Crumble

Description

Succulent prosciutto-wrapped pears topped with tangy blue cheese crumble make for a sophisticated appetizer that’s perfect for fall gatherings. This easy-to-make dish combines sweet fruit with salty meat and creamy cheese for a flavor explosion in every bite.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 ripe pears, halved and cored
  • 8 thin slices prosciutto, halved lengthwise
  • 1/2 cup crumbled blue cheese
  • 1/4 cup panko breadcrumbs
  • 1 tbsp melted butter
  • 1 tbsp chopped fresh rosemary
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 400°F.
  2. Wrap each pear half with a slice of prosciutto.
  3. In a bowl, mix blue cheese, breadcrumbs, butter, rosemary, salt, and pepper.
  4. Sprinkle the crumble on top of the wrapped pears.
  5. Place on a baking sheet and bake for 15-20 minutes until golden.

Notes

Serve warm as an appetizer. Can be made ahead and reheated.
